Hydrogen bonding in some adducts of oxygen bases with acids. Part III. Dielectric studies

Abstract

Dielectric titrations were performed to establish the composition of complexes formed between bases with X–O groups (X = N, S, or P) and some carboxylic acids, and phenols. In all cases the stoichiometric ratio 1 : 1 was found. The dipole moments of the adducts were estimated and the Δµ values, i.e., the increase of the dipole moment due to hydrogen bonding was deduced for various mutual orientations of the interacting components.
